Oman to Host First International Conference on Business Sustainability and Investment Enhancement in Muscat

Muscat, The Gulf Observer: The Sultanate of Oman is set to host its first international conference on business sustainability and enhancing the investment system, commencing Monday at the campus of the University of Technology and Applied Sciences in Muscat.
Organised in partnership with the Ministry of Commerce, Industry and Investment Promotion, the two-day conference aims to provide a comprehensive scientific and professional platform, bringing together decision-makers, industry leaders, academics, researchers, and investors from across the region and beyond.
The conference will focus on critical themes such as business sustainability, innovation, and the enhancement of Oman’s investment climate. It aligns with the Sultanate’s broader national agenda to strengthen its position as a competitive and sustainable investment destination, in line with the objectives of Oman Vision 2040.
Key topics on the agenda include foreign direct investment, public-private partnerships, regulatory reforms, innovation, and long-term economic sustainability. These discussions are expected to generate actionable insights to support the continued development of Oman’s investment ecosystem.
Dr. Khalid bin Salem Al-Abri, Assistant President of the university, stated that the conference is designed to foster dialogue, facilitate knowledge exchange, and build strategic partnerships among stakeholders. He emphasized that the event will contribute to generating innovative ideas and practical recommendations to enhance the Sultanate’s economic landscape.
He further noted that hosting the conference reflects the university’s commitment to its academic and societal role in advancing economic development and strengthening collaboration between educational institutions and both public and private sectors.
The conference is also expected to provide valuable networking opportunities and a platform to explore emerging trends, challenges, and opportunities in business sustainability at both local and global levels. It underscores the growing role of higher education institutions in shaping policies and practices that promote investment, innovation, and sustainable development.
